A few years ago a good friend of mine gave me a birthday present. It was a cute white purse of a Brazilian brand. I loved the brand so much that I wanted to buy stuff for myself. I found out the brand was only sold in Brazil and other South American countries. This is when I thought ”Why can’t this brand be sold in the US?”.
I thought that having a platform to sell Latin American brands who are not sold in the US was the perfect idea.
This is how Mint Pudú was founded! Mint Pudú is the platform where you can have access to amazing brands from Latin America.
I did a lot of research and finally got in contact with the brand, Capodarte.
I started with Capodarte, but I already have in mind lots of other brands which I am sure will do great in the American market.
Why Mint Pudú? Green is personally my favorite color especially the mint shade and the Pudú is the smallest deer on earth located only in South America especially in Chile, Argentina Peru.
The combination of both made the perfect match.
Alright, so let’s dig a little deeper into the story – has it been an easy path overall and if not, what were the challenges you’ve had to overcome?
The process took about a year, from the time I got in contact with the brand up until the goods were imported in the US. The struggle was the long wait! since the products were made to order, the process took a few months. Also, since the import/export world is crazy right now, that also affected the delay with the import.
